-.SH "NAME"
-pam_mkhomedir \- PAM module to create users home directory
-.SH "SYNOPSIS"
-.HP 17
-\fBpam_mkhomedir.so\fR [silent] [umask=\fImode\fR] [skel=\fIskeldir\fR]
-.SH "DESCRIPTION"
-.PP
-The pam_mkhomedir PAM module will create a users home directory if it does not exist when the session begins. This allows users to be present in central database (such as NIS, kerberos or LDAP) without using a distributed file system or pre\-creating a large number of directories. The skeleton directory (usually
-\fI/etc/skel/\fR) is used to copy default files and also set's a umask for the creation.
-.PP
-The new users home directory will not be removed after logout of the user.
-.SH "OPTIONS"
-.TP 3n
-\fBsilent\fR
-Don't print informative messages.
-.TP 3n
-\fBumask=\fR\fB\fImask\fR\fR
-The user file\-creation mask is set to
-\fImask\fR. The default value of mask is 0022.
-.TP 3n
-\fBskel=\fR\fB\fI/path/to/skel/directory\fR\fR
-Indicate an alternative
-\fIskel\fR
-directory to override the default
-\fI/etc/skel\fR.
